Juncus phaeocephalus

Brownhead Rush
Also known as: Juncus phaeocephalus var. glomeratus Engelm. +1 more
  • Juncus phaeocephalus var. glomeratus Engelm.
  • Juncus xiphioides var. glomeratus Hoover
Botanical Data
  • Taxonomic Rank: Species
  • Botanical Family: Juncaceae
  • WCVP Morphological Data: Recorded natively as a perennial or rhizomatous geophyte.

Juncus phaeocephalus (commonly known as Brownhead Rush) is a rush within the Juncaceae family. It is found natively in North America. In its natural range, this species typically occurs in temperate conditions. There are naturally occurring varieties of this species, which are linked below.

Native Range

Continents (WGSRPD)
NORTHERN AMERICA
Regions (WGSRPD)
Mexico, Northwestern U.S.A., Southwestern U.S.A.
Botanical Countries (WGSRPD L3)
California, Mexico Northwest, Oregon, Washington
